SUBJECT:
An Ordinance Levying Taxes for the City of Aurora, Illinois, for the Fiscal Year January 1, 2021 through December 31, 2021.

PURPOSE:
To facilitate the City Council's passage of the proposed 2021 property tax levies for the City.

BACKGROUND:
The city obtains the resources for its operations through a variety of sources. The annual property tax levy provides a major share of our revenue - approximately 20% of the revenue for all city funds and about 46% of the revenue for the General Fund.

35 ILCS 200/18-60 requires that each taxing district in Illinois determine an estimate of monies to be raised by the taxation of taxable property not later than 20 days prior to adoption of a tax levy. Estimates of the 2021 property tax levies for the city were included in the proposed 2022 City Budget released on October 22, 2021.

DISCUSSION:
Attached as Exhibit 1 is a schedule presenting historical information related to the city's annual tax levies, tax rates, and assessed valuation. Attached as Exhibit 2 is the proposed 2021 property tax levy ordinances for the city, respectively.

As shown in Exhibit 2, the proposed city tax levy totals $83,477,500 (including city debt service). This is the same amount as the 2020 levy.

The following are the key dates leading to the passage of our 2021 property tax levies.

11/23/2021 Proposed tax levy ordinances considered by the Finance Committee.

12/7/2021 Proposed tax levy ordinances considered by the Committee of the Whole.

12/14/2021 City Council adopts tax levy ordinances during its regular meeting.

12/28/2021 Last day for filing tax levy ordinances with the county clerks.


IMPACT STATEMENT:
Adoption of the 2021 Tax Levy Provides required funding for the City's General Operating, Police, and Firefighter's Pension Funds.
